Als «sh» getaggte Fragen

sh steht für eine Muschel. Es wird auch häufig als Erweiterung für ein Shell-Skript verwendet.

584
Was macht "Quelle"?

$ whatis source source: nothing appropriate. $ man source No manual entry for source $ source bash: source: filename argument required source: usage: source filename [arguments] Es existiert und ist lauffähig. Warum gibt es in Ubuntu keine Dokumentation dazu? Was tut es? Wie kann ich Dokumentation...

352
Was ist zufällige Kunst, die von ssh-keygen erzeugt wird?

Wenn Sie einen Schlüssel generieren, erhalten Sie "randomart" von neueren Versionen von OpenSSH. Ich kann keine Erklärung dafür finden, warum und wofür ich es verwenden soll. Generating public/private rsa key pair. The key fingerprint is: 05:1e:1e:c1:ac:b9:d1:1c:6a:60:ce:0f:77:6c:78:47 you@i The...

332
Ein SSH-Tunnel über mehrere Hops

Das Tunneln von Daten über SSH ist ziemlich einfach: ssh -D9999 [email protected] Richtet Port 9999 auf Ihrem localhostals Tunnel ein example.com, aber ich habe einen genaueren Bedarf: Ich arbeite vor Ort an localhost host1 ist zugänglich für localhost host2 Akzeptiert nur Verbindungen von host1...

312
chown ändert den symbolischen Link nicht

Ich versuche, den Benutzer / die Gruppe eines symbolischen Links mit dem folgenden Befehl zu ändern: $ chown -h myuser:mygroup mysymbolic/ Aber es ändert sich nicht. Ich bin als root angemeldet. Der aktuelle Benutzer / die aktuelle Gruppe wird auf root gesetzt: root. Was schief gelaufen...

306
Zurück zum vorherigen Verzeichnis in der Shell

Gibt es eine Möglichkeit, zum vorherigen Verzeichnis zurückzukehren, in dem wir bash, tcsh verwendet haben, ohne pushd / popd zu verwenden? Ich möchte etwas wie "back" eingeben und kehre zum vorherigen Verzeichnis zurück, in dem ich mich befunden habe. Bearbeiten: "cd -" funktioniert, aber nur für...

285
Wie füge ich Text am Anfang einer Datei in Bash ein?

Hallo, ich möchte einer Datei Text voranstellen. Zum Beispiel möchte ich Aufgaben am Anfang einer todo.txt-Datei hinzufügen. Mir ist bewusst, echo 'task goes here' >> todo.txtaber das fügt die Zeile an das Ende der Datei (nicht was ich

245
Wie kann ich eine SSH-Verbindung beenden?

Ich verbinde mich über SSH mit einem Server, um eine Nachricht an einen Socket-Server zu senden. ssh 181.169.1.2 -p 5566 Nachdem die Verbindung hergestellt wurde und ich die Nachricht geschrieben und gesendet habe, kann ich den Textmodus nicht verlassen. Ich darf nur mehr Text eingeben und das...

225
Bash: Zeilen in einer Variablen durchlaufen

Wie iteriert man richtig über Zeilen in Bash, entweder in einer Variablen oder aus der Ausgabe eines Befehls? Das einfache Setzen der IFS-Variablen auf eine neue Zeile funktioniert für die Ausgabe eines Befehls, nicht jedoch beim Verarbeiten einer Variablen, die neue Zeilen enthält. Zum...